Canadian banks should evaluate AI-ready contract engineers across four areas: engineering fundamentals, AI fluency, responsible AI judgment, and role-specific AI engineering skills. The strongest candidates can use AI productively, validate its output, protect sensitive data, identify security and model risks, and make sound decisions within a regulated banking environment. AI has impacted technical assessment formats in different ways. Code tests and take-home assessments now provide less reliable hiring signals. Because candidates can use AI to generate complete solutions, these asynchronous and output-based assessments offer less insight into a candidate’s true capabilities.
